What are the responsibilities and job description for the RESOURCE CENTER SPECIALIST position at City of Surprise?
The City of Surprise Resource Center is seeking its next dynamic team member to join our Community Action Program (CAP) assisting residents of Surprise, El Mirage, Waddell, Wittman and Sun City. If you are passionate about providing support services that foster self-sufficiency and stability during unexpected financial crises, are detail-oriented, and enjoy working in a fast-paced environment, the Surprise Resource Center is looking for you! The Resource Center Specialist completes a high volume of applications for housing and utility financial assistance in a timely and accurate manner.
SUMMARY
Incumbents coordinate the processes of the Community Action Program (CAP) service provisions utilizing multiple funding sources to determine applicant eligibility. Incumbents are responsible for the direct intake of information from applicants requesting services, providing assistance with identifying and recruiting essential community services, assisting residents in finding and applying for services utilizing case management practices and principals. Incumbents assist with programs offered at the Resource Center and provide support to other related neighborhood projects and activities.
EDUCATION and/or EXPERIENCE
High School Diploma or G.E.D and two (2) years related experience in the human services, social services, housing programs, non-profit agencies and/or other related experience sufficient to successfully perform the essential duties of the job such as those listed in the job description. Additional education cannot be substituted for experience.
CERTIFICATIONS, L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S
Must have at time of hire and be able to maintain a valid Arizona driver license. Must provide proof of having a Fingerprint Clearance Card (FCC) from the Arizona Department of Public Safety within 7 days of hire, or provide proof of having applied for the Fingerprint Clearance Card (FCC) within 7 days of hire. The cost of obtaining a FCC will be provided by the Human Services & Community Vitality department.
